Eva Bang Harvald is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Aging. According to data from OpenAlex, Eva Bang Harvald has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 358 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Physiology and 4 papers in Aging. Recurrent topics in Eva Bang Harvald’s work include Genetics, Aging, and Longevity in Model Organisms (4 papers), Tissue Engineering and Regenerative Medicine (3 papers)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(2 papers). Eva Bang Harvald is often cited by papers focused on Genetics, Aging, and Longevity in Model Organisms (4 papers), Tissue Engineering and Regenerative Medicine (3 papers) and Electrospun Nanofibers in Biomedical Applications (2 papers). Eva Bang Harvald collaborates with scholars based in Denmark, Russia and Japan. Eva Bang Harvald's co-authors include Nils J. Færgeman, Anne S. Olsen, Ditte Caroline Andersen, Christer S. Ejsing, Jes S. Lindholt, Sandra F. Gallego, Hans Kristian Hannibal‐Bach, Rikke Kruse, Angus I. Lamond and Susanne Mandrup and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Developmental Cell and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
